The objective of the Macquarie Enhanced Property Securities managed fund is The Macquarie Enhanced Property Securities Fund aims to outperform the S&P/ASX 200 Property Trust Accumulation Index over the medium term to long term (before fees) by using a low risk investment strategy.
The strategy of the Macquarie Enhanced Property Securities managed fund is The Fund's enhanced listed real estate securities investment process uses index replication for the majority of the portfolio with scope to add value above the index return through risk-controlled active positions.
